🐛 Describe the bug

When running a 2p2d B200 node configuration with Deepseek v3.1 in DP=16 + DBO for decode, the decode node is encountering a hang at high concurrency (saw this at 2k and at 4k) where requests stop completing.

15 of 16 decode DP ranks are on line:

  File "/app/venv/lib/python3.12/site-packages/torch/cuda/streams.py", line 231, in synchronize
    super().synchronize()
  File "/app/vllm/vllm/v1/worker/gpu_model_runner.py", line 4046, in _to_list
    self.transfer_event.synchronize()

and 1 of 16 ranks (rank 7) are at:

  <built-in method linear of module object at remote 0x7b3806783100>
  File "/app/vllm/vllm/model_executor/layers/utils.py", line 92, in default_unquantized_gemm
    return torch.nn.functional.linear(x, weight, bias)
  File "/app/vllm/vllm/model_executor/layers/vocab_parallel_embedding.py", line 53, in apply
    return dispatch_unquantized_gemm()(layer, x, layer.weight, bias)
  File "/app/vllm/vllm/model_executor/layers/logits_processor.py", line 90, in _get_logits
    logits = lm_head.quant_method.apply(lm_head,
  File "/app/vllm/vllm/model_executor/layers/logits_processor.py", line 58, in forward
    logits = self._get_logits(hidden_states, lm_head, embedding_bias)

Configuration for decode ranks 0-7

Prefill server appears to have no issue (DBO is not enabled).

Benchmark is 1:100 in:out
